Jelajahi alam semesta tak berujung yang dipenuhi planet eksotis, bentuk kehidupan aneh, dan peradaban kuno dalam game eksplorasi ruang angkasa berbasis teks ini. Kelola kru penjelajah luar angkasa dan tingkatkan kapal mereka dengan teknologi baru. Berani dunia berbahaya untuk mengumpulkan data yang Anda butuhkan untuk mencapai sistem rumah dari Gatebuilders misterius.Apa Yang Baru
1.1.5 PATCH NOTES
* Revised Epic event text that didn't make sense if only one explorer was alive
* Volcanic sulphur dusting can no longer spawn on high gravity worlds
* If you continue in endless mode after losing your ship in the endgame, the "this is the ship's Nth trip" counter resets to reflect that it's a new ship
* Fixed a couple of discoveries missing tooltips
* Several typo fixes
* Android version is now built for Android 14

Almost flawless experience, I mean truly phenomenal stuff. It's both a creative and very impressive showcase of text based game design, like an expanded vision of seedship, although if there were anything I could say is negative about the experience it would be that sometimes events can get a bit repetitive after awhile, along with the randomly picked names for civilizations having the same problem. other than those two quite small issues this is a solid experience. 9.5/10 good stuff.

Definitely in the same category as Seedship but it adds more complexity, more dimensions to the decisions you make. I liked Seedship enough that I was happy to pay $10, regardless of how much I ended up liking Chiron Gate, but it turned out it's a great game and too. I just finished a game and really enjoyed it. Some reviewers say the game is too hard, but you just need to be conservative, once you start to figure out what's dangerous, take fewer risks to avoid injuring your crew.

A fun little text-based adventure. Overall a very impressive, fun experience, with just a few flaws: More variety in encounters could go a long way. You'll see most of the different encounters within a few hours. The RNG could use some weighting as the game goes on - it sucks to have almost all your scanners upgraded but be greeted by a selection of barren systems late-game. Why would a heavily injured explorer still go out as part of a shore party? Overall, it's good. Try it out.

I loved Seedship, with its excellent writing and varied tactics. While this game also has wonderful sci-fi writing, it soon becomes extremely repetitive, clicking through the same paragraphs over and over. The roguelite pacing is counterintuitive, that to get the most points one has to follow a very boring, predictable. Unlike Seedship, it feels like I must grind my way through, that there is only one way to win, and that getting a high score isn't a fun way to play. Terribly overpriced too.
